In a surprising turn of events, early gameplay footage of the highly anticipated next installment of the Fable series was unveiled during the Official Xbox Podcast. The video offers fans a glimpse into various enchanting locations within the game world, showcasing the combat system, an array of enemies, and a snippet of a captivating cutscene. Notably, the iconic chicken kick, a beloved feature from the series, makes a delightful return.
Previously, the head of Xbox Game Studios announced a delay for Fable, pushing its release from 2025 to 2026. The decision was made to ensure additional polish and refinement, a common necessity in game development to deliver a top-quality experience.
The reboot of the iconic Fable series was first announced on July 23, 2020, sparking excitement among fans. However, in the three years following the announcement, details about the game remained scarce, indicating that Fable was still in the early stages of development.
The involvement of Playground Games, the main developer, alongside assistance from Eidos Montreal, underscores the complexity of the project.
